📌 I. Product Definition & Classification: Do You Really Understand "Puppets and Dolls"?
In international trade, the term "Puppet Doll" is often a colloquial umbrella term that covers distinct customs categories. It generally includes: 1. Interactive Puppets/Toys: Hand puppets, marionettes, and dolls intended for children's play (classified under Chapter 95). 2. Ornamental Dolls/Statuettes: Decorative items, fashion dolls (like Barbie), or collectible figures intended for display, not primarily for play (classified under Chapter 39 or other relevant chapters depending on material).
⚠️ Key Distinction Point:
- If the item is intended for use by children (as a toy or play item) → It falls under HS Code 9503.
- If the item is strictly decorative, an ornamental article, or an imitation gemstone/statuette not for play → It may fall under HS Code 3926.

🔍 Key Reminder:
- The distinction between 9503 and 3926 hinges on "Intended Use".
- If a doll/puppet is labeled for children (Under 3 or 3-12), it must be declared as a "Children's Product" under 9503.
- If it is a decorative statuette or ornamental bow for adults/home decor, it may fall under 3926.40.00.10.
- Misclassification Risk: Declaring a children's toy as an "ornamental article" to avoid stricter toy safety regulations (CPC, CPSIA) is a major compliance violation.

📌 VI. Common Mistakes & Pitfall Guide (Lessons from Blood & Tears)
❌ Mistake 1: Declaring a children's toy as "Plastic Ornament" (3926) to avoid CPC.
👉 Consequence: CBP seizure, fines, forced recall, and blacklisting of importer.
👉 Truth: Toys are toys. Age labeling dictates HS Code.
❌ Mistake 2: Confusing "Under 3" and "3-12" codes.
👉 Consequence: Minor discrepancy, but if a toy for 3-12 is declared under .71, it may flag for stricter infant safety checks.
👉 Truth: Match the actual intended age group on the packaging.
❌ Mistake 3: Calling a collectible action figure a "toy".
👉 Consequence: If the marketing targets adults (18+), it might be argued as decor (3926), but CBP often still views them as toys.
👉 Truth: Check CBP Rulings. Many "collectibles" are still ruled under 9503. Get an Advance Ruling.
❌ Mistake 4: Ignoring Lead Paint or Choking Hazards in decorative items.
👉 Consequence: Even 3926 items must meet general safety standards if they resemble toys.
👉 Truth: If it looks like a toy, treat it like a toy.
✅ Correct Approach:
"Vinyl Hand Puppet, PVC Material, Age Label: 3+, Intended for Play, ASTM F963 Compliant" → HS 9503.00.00.73
"Plastic Resin Statuette, Decorative Home Accessory, No Age Label, Intended for Display" → HS 3926.40.00.10

协调制度(HS)是由世界海关组织(WCO)制定的国际贸易商品分类标准。全球 200 多个国家采用 HS 系统作为海关关税、贸易统计和进出口监管的基础。
每个 HS 编码遵循以下层级结构:
- 章(2 位)——商品大类(例如:第 84 章:机器和机械设备)
- 品目(4 位)——章内的更具体分类
- 子目(6 位)——国际通用细分,所有 WCO 成员国统一使用
- 本国细分(8-10 位)——各国自行扩展的细分编码,如美国 HTSUS 10 位编码
正确的 HS 编码归类对于顺利通关、准确缴纳关税和遵守贸易法规至关重要。错误归类可能导致海关延误、多缴关税或罚款。
